Mobile numbers in the EU.A call is made to a ported telephone number. The Initiating Service Provider’s switch launches a query to find out if the number has been ported; If yes, the LRN of the new switch is provided; If no, the call is routed based on the telephone number . You'll get the code via an SMS message from 1901. The code is notably valid for four days (30 days in case of Jammu and Kashmir).Number Portability. Number portability, which is required by applicable rules and procedures established by the Federal Communications Commission (FCC), allows customers or end users to transfer their telephone numbers to other providers. Carriers also may have individualized systems and processes to handle porting activity. The Mobile Number Portability Code sets out the procedures for porting a mobile phone number between telcos. The key requirements include: before porting a number, you must check that the customer is the rights-of-use holder. 90% of ports must be completed within 3 hours. 99% of ports must be completed within 2 business days.
